Augustiner Keller
 
Aside from the beer, how is the food here? I am not a beer drinker but my husband is and wants to go to a beer hall. Thanks for the advice.

uncle sam Jan 12th, 2003 11:31 AM

I assume you mean the one in Munich. The food is quite good German beer hall fare. It is reasonably priced, IMHO the beer is th best in Munich and it is where the Germans go rather than to the touristy Hofbrau Haus where drunk tourists can in fact ruin a good evening!<BR><BR>US

CharlieB Jan 12th, 2003 01:02 PM

Bsrbara - for once I have to agree with US. Augustiner Kellar, I think has the best food of any large Keller in Munich and is certainly much less rauchous than the Hofbrau Haus. Entirely different experiences.

rar Jan 12th, 2003 01:43 PM

Their bavarian sampler dish is really good (worth the 14 euro). I'd try that. And see if you can get seated down in the lower area of the keller, it has a fun atmosphere.<BR><BR>Make sure you try their dark beer at least once, it makes a great dessert beer.

Melissa Jan 12th, 2003 04:42 PM

The prices were good, but I thought Augustiner Keller's portions were waaaaaayyyyyyy too big for one person! If you are not usually a big eater, you might want to order a plate to share.<BR><BR>I am also not a beer drinker. Do you like wine? Maybe you can go to Augustiner Keller one night and then Pfalzer Weinstube the next. I thought Pfalzer Weinstube's food was better.

Where in Munich is the Augustiner Keller located? Anyone.

uncle sam Jan 12th, 2003 06:47 PM

It is about three blocks form the Hauptbahnhof.<BR><BR>If you were to look at the front of the Hauuptbahnhof, then you would go up the sreet that is on the right hand side of the HB for about three blocks. It is just at the top of a rise on the right hand side of the street.<BR><BR>US

Augustinerkeller is located in main pedestrian street - rest of details as per uncle sam's email. Not as touristy as Hofbrauhaus but still pretty touristy given location. My preference is for much smaller pub (best rated n local Munich restaurant guides) - Andechs located on Weinstrasse behind the cathedral. Beer is regarded extremely highly - after all produced in the Church (in the Kloster south of Munich). As it so much smaller than the Augustiner, you will have to sit with others - so can get a proper Munich pub feel. Much more quaint. Food is very good - one of the best vegetarian meals I have had was there (and I am no vegetarian).
